Summary
Rhabdoid melanoma, an uncommon variant, presents diagnostic challenges due to marker loss. This case highlights rhabdoid differentiation in primary melanoma and the recurrence of this aggressive clone.
Area of Science:
- Dermatology
- Oncology
- Pathology
Background:
- Melanoma with rhabdoid features is a rare variant with unclear pathogenesis.
- Questions persist about rhabdoid differentiation and its potential common pathway across malignancies.
Observation:
- A case of primary melanoma exhibiting rhabdoid features is presented.
- Immunohistochemistry revealed loss of melanoma-specific markers.
- Vimentin showed paranuclear accentuation, consistent with ultrastructural findings.
Findings:
- The study documents rhabdoid differentiation within a primary melanoma.
- A recurrent rhabdoid clone was identified, suggesting more aggressive behavior.
- Diagnostic challenges associated with this melanoma variant were highlighted.
Implications:
- This case deepens understanding of rhabdoid melanoma pathogenesis.
- It underscores the importance of considering rhabdoid differentiation in challenging melanoma diagnoses.
- Further research into the aggressive nature of recurrent rhabdoid clones is warranted.

The Retinoblastoma Gene
Tumor suppressor genes are normal genes that can slow down cell division, repair DNA mistakes, or program the cells for apoptosis in case of irreparable damage. Hence, they play an essential role in preventing the proliferation of damaged cells.
The first-ever tumor suppressor gene called Rb was identified in retinoblastoma - a rare eye tumor in children. In inherited forms of the disease, a child inherits one defective copy of the Rb gene, which predisposes them to retinoblastoma. However,...

Skin Cancer
Skin cancer is a type of cancer that occurs when there is an abnormal growth of skin cells, usually triggered by damage to the DNA within the skin cells. It is primarily caused by exposure to ultraviolet (UV) radiation from the sun or artificial sources like tanning beds. Skin cancer is the most common type of cancer worldwide, and its incidence continues to rise.

Abnormal Proliferation
Under normal conditions, most adult cells remain in a non-proliferative state unless stimulated by internal or external factors to replace lost cells. Abnormal cell proliferation is a condition in which the cell's growth exceeds and is uncoordinated with normal cells. In such situations, cell division persists in the same excessive manner even after cessation of the stimuli, leading to persistent tumors.
